STRX006: Satellite Trax presents “Stone Wheel EP” - an arsenal of dancefloor anthems by Sam Bottoni, best known as @sambot. Pre-order: sat-era.bandcamp.com/album/stone-wheel-ep-strx006 The next offering from our in-demand Satellite Trax sublabel brings us just north of our HQ in Madison as we finally connect with an electrifying club music maker. When it comes to the Midwest, you really do not have to travel far to find a hardworking artist that is deserving of the spotlight. Our first encounter with Sam Link and his growing collection of dancefloor sonics came in 2022 while digitally crate digging on Bandcamp. We were astonished to learn that these tracks were not coming from an unknown bedroom producer in the UK, but rather from an emerging talent out of the great state of Wisconsin. His work then made it to our friends at YUKU, a prolific label pushing forward-thinking art out of Prague. The familiarity in his sound implies that he is a student of formative club music from across the pond, yet his take on it feels more than just a nostalgic recreation. Sam Link’s obsession with late-90s jungle and drum ‘n’ bass makes his productions feel like a balanced blend of rustic influences with modern, high-fidelity characteristics. This can be heard throughout “Stone Wheel EP,” his latest contribution to the global market of dancefloor weaponry. The project wastes no time in raising the energy with its title track - groovy percussive elements are layered over its heavy bassline, serving as a proper introduction. Already a favorite of our DJ allies that are giving it early playtime, “Mae” is a dark twist to the EP with its rattling low-end and off-kilter structure. “Dusk Pan” is a showcase of jungle down to its simplest form, where its breakbeats are allowed to shine and the sample selection can be flaunted. “Hellp” explores a jazzy side of the project, while still being held together by grueling bass and shuffling percussion. To demonstrate his passion for our music history, Sam Link recruited one of Chicago’s most prominent figures in its niche drum ‘n’ bass community. Stunna takes on remix duties for “Hellp,” turning up the tempo and fusing an old-school DnB style with soulful traits that leave it on an uplifting note. Disclaimer: “Stone Wheel EP” contains serious bass weight. As some of Sam Link’s best work yet, the project solidifies that he is more than just an underground up-and-comer. He is ready to elevate his status from a renowned local DJ, to a household name in the dance music sphere. With each of his new releases freshening up the club circuit, we have no doubt that the growth in audience will happen soon enough. Satellite Trax - an expansion of our core imprint that focuses on dance-centric music and its club roots; part of the foundation within our sonic heritage. This sublabel serves as a primary source of dancefloor weaponry for DJs and enthusiasts aiming to unveil the latest rhythms heard from around the electronic music sphere. Written & produced by Sam Bottoni "Hellp" remixed by Jay Cappo Mastered by Amir Mashayekhi Cover art & visual by Nic Juister
